Yes it is a 32" sub, yes it was produced in limited quantities. With a 3299 msrp or something crazy like that. Max power was 1000 watts, and it required a huge enclosure something like 12+ cubic feet.
And it only does 150's..... do you know how loud 150dbs actually is? 150dbs is compared to a shotgun blast at point blank range to your ears. Most of the systems on the market for 2 woofer one sub amp systems arent even at 150db's.
170db is the sound of a jet engine at close range.
